Understanding Auto Body Damage Assessment

damaged car bumper

An auto body damage assessment is a crucial step in understanding the extent and cost of repairs needed for your vehicle after an accident or collision. It’s more than just looking at dents; it involves a thorough inspection to identify structural integrity issues, frame damage, and other hidden problems that could affect safety and performance. A skilled assessor will use advanced tools and techniques to determine if parts need replacement, repair, or even complete car restoration.

This process is essential for getting accurate quotes from collision damage repair shops. It ensures you’re aware of all the work required before agreeing on a repair plan. Key Questions to Ask During Inspection

damaged car bumper

During an auto body damage assessment, asking the right questions can help ensure a thorough inspection and accurate estimate for repairs. Some key queries to pose include: “What specific areas show signs of damage?” and “Can you point out any hidden or internal damage?” Understanding the extent of the harm is crucial. Inquire about the experience level of the assessors to gauge their expertise, as this can impact the precision of the evaluation.

Additionally, it’s important to ask about the body shop services offered and whether they specialize in specific types of auto body repair. Questions like “Do you provide on-site repairs?” or “How do you handle insurance claims?” can offer insights into the collision repair shop’s capabilities and efficiency. Knowing the process ahead of time helps set expectations for both the owner and the automotive repair experts.

Evaluating Repairs: What to Consider Afterward

damaged car bumper

After a thorough auto body damage assessment, the next crucial step is evaluating the recommended repairs. This process requires careful consideration of several factors to ensure your vehicle returns to its pre-accident condition or surpasses it in terms of performance and aesthetics. Start by understanding the extent of each identified damage; is it merely cosmetic or does it involve structural integrity issues? For instance, a dented fender might be an easily reparable automotive body work task, while a crumpled chassis requires more complex mercedes benz collision repair techniques.

Additionally, consider the availability and quality of replacement parts. Original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ts guarantee better compatibility and performance compared to aftermarket alternatives. The skill level required for specific repairs is another vital factor; some car bodywork tasks may be suitable for DIY enthusiasts, while others demand expert hands.
